Nestled within the vibrant Borough of Barnet in North West London, Hendon Train Station serves as a vital hub for travelers and daily passengers. Its strategic location offers an easy gateway to numerous destinations, making it a popular choice for commuters and explorers alike. Operating on the Thameslink line, this station provides reliable rail services connecting you efficiently to Central London and beyond.
Hendon Station is equipped with facilities designed to make your journey smooth and convenient. Ticket purchasing and collection options include a ticket office available from Monday to Saturday, along with accessible ticket machines. Smartcard services like issuance and validation are supported, simplifying the travel experience for commuters.
Accessibility at Hendon is partial, with step-free access available from the car park to platform 1, suitable for those traveling towards London. It is important to note that other platforms require steps. For travelers requiring assistance, the station offers staff help during ticket office opening hours, and there's a mobile assistance team on call should you need it. The station also houses a customer help point to facilitate your journey, though it lacks certain amenities such as luggage storage and waiting lounges.
While basic seating is provided, the station does not have heated waiting rooms or refreshment facilities. There are 43 car parking spaces available, with the added benefit of 5 accessible spots. Bicycle storage is ample, offering 64 spaces in sheltered racks. For security, CCTV is installed across the station.
Planning your onward journey from Hendon is easy, thanks to its excellent transport links. Although there is no direct cycle hire or accessible taxis at the station, Hendon is well connected through local bus services with a comprehensive onward travel information map available for your convenience. Whether you're a seasoned commuter or a first-time visitor, West Sutton train station offers a gateway to not only the bustling city of London but also various other exciting destinations. With a serene neighborhood atmosphere, the station acts as a vital link for daily commuters and travelers who find themselves navigating the South London rail lines.
The station is unmanned, so there is no ticket office available, but fret not. Ticket machines around the station ensure you can collect your tickets purchased online or buy them directly with ease. If you are eligible for discounts, accessible ticket machines can apply Disabled Persons Railcard reductions ensuring inclusivity. Travellers should note that while the ticket machines are accessible by design, the station itself lacks step-free access, which may pose a challenge for those with reduced mobility.
Need some extra assistance? While there aren't staff help points, you can arrange for assisted travel. It’s advisable to book this service ahead of time to ensure all arrangements are in place at your destination station. Note that West Sutton station does not include amenities such as toilets, refreshments, shops, or Wi-Fi - so plan ahead to meet those needs before your arrival.
Thinking about extending your journey beyond the train ride? Perfect! West Sutton offers several connections that make it easy to continue your travel. While the nearest bus services are accessible, specific details will demand guidance from the Onward Travel Information Map on-site. The station does not feature taxi ranks or cycle hire facilities, but bicycle stands are available for those preferring to pedal to their next stop.
